Hypergrowth Salary

How much does the Hypergrowth Pay for employees?

As of August 2026, the average annual salary for employees at Hypergrowth in the United States is $99,394. This translates to an approximate hourly wage of $48. Salaries at Hypergrowth typically range from $87,182 to $112,635 annually, reflecting the diverse roles and experience levels within the company. Hypergrowth’s salaries are influenced by a wide range of factors including job role, department, years of experience, and location.

3. How does experience level affect salary at Hypergrowth?

Experience level is a significant factor in determining salary at Hypergrowth, as it is with most employers. Generally, employees with more years of relevant experience and a proven track record can command higher salaries. For example, a senior-level role will typically have a higher pay band than an entry-level or mid-career position within the same job family.

4. What factors influence salary increases at Hypergrowth?

Salary increases at Hypergrowth are likely influenced by a combination of factors, including: individual employee performance against set goals, overall company performance and profitability, budget availability, changes in the market rate for similar roles (market adjustments), and sometimes cost-of-living increases.
